President Christián Avellar was the President of the Raven Alliance from 3135 until at least 3151.[1][2][3]
Personal Appearance[edit]
Christián was considered to be morbidly obese, especially by the Clan Snow Raven warriors within the Raven Alliance.[1]
History[edit]
The grandson of Mitchell Avellar, and younger son of Hugo Avellar, Christián did not expect growing up to succeed to his family's role as Raven Alliance President. His focus as a young man were therefore on literary pursuits, anonymously entering writing competitions which he often won. His writing was primarily satire, often using an allegorical fictional world where humans are ruled by a confusing race of giant birds, which stand in for the Alliance's ruling Clan Snow Raven. He was also a hedonist of the highest degree, who loved eating good food to excess.
Despite his gentle dissent from the Alliance's Clan rulers, and strong sense of Outworlds national pride, he was however chosen by the Raven Council to become President after his father's death by suicide in 3135. This was considered to be due to his brother Eustace Avellar's rumored involvement in extremist anti-Raven organizations, and Khan Sterling McKenna's fondness for Christián.[1]
